Hail Damage Risk for Your Home +

Hail reports describe hail by diameter, often comparing stone size to familiar objects like peas, quarters, golf balls, and softballs. Use this guide as a starting point for possible hail damage to your roof, siding, gutters, vents, windows, and exterior. Actual hail damage depends on hail hardness, density, wind speed, impact angle, roof age, shingle condition, roof pitch, roofing material, installation quality, and prior storm damage.

Source: NOAA / National Weather Service hail size references are used for hail-size comparisons and the 1.00″ severe-hail threshold. Damage descriptions are general homeowner guidance, not official NOAA/NWS damage ratings. Sub-severe hail under 1.00″ is below the severe threshold, but that does not mean “no roof damage.” Penny- to nickel-size hail can still contribute to granule loss, cosmetic surface marks, and added wear, especially on older, brittle, poorly installed, or previously damaged roofs.

Wind Damage Risk for Your Home +

Storm reports list thunderstorm wind gusts in mph. The NWS marks storms as severe at 58+ mph, but wind damage to your home depends on roof age, shingle condition, installation, exposure, nearby trees, and prior hail or wind damage.

Tornado Damage Risk for Your Home +

After a tornado, the National Weather Service assigns an EF rating from EF0 to EF5 based on surveyed damage. The rating estimates wind speed from what the tornado damaged, so actual damage can vary by construction quality, roof age, garage doors, windows, trees, debris, and how close the home was to the tornado path.

Source: NOAA / National Weather Service. EF ratings are assigned after a post-storm damage survey and are based on observed damage, not a direct measurement at every home.

Some reports show UNK instead of a wind speed or tornado rating — what does that mean?

Wind reports come three ways: measured from an instrument, estimated from the damage observed, or UNK when no speed was recorded. Tornadoes show UNK until the National Weather Service finishes a damage survey and assigns an EF rating. UNK simply means that value was not available when the report was filed.
